Bybit pays up to 50 percent of trading fees on a tiered structure. New affiliates typically start around 30 percent. Volume thresholds unlock higher tiers toward 50 percent. CPA structures available for approved partners. Commission paid in crypto. Not available for US-based affiliates or US audience traffic. Best for non-US crypto content targeting Asian, European, and Middle Eastern markets.

The geo restriction on US is hard. If you're in the US or your primary audience is US-based, stop here and look at Coinbase or Kraken instead. For everyone else, Bybit's derivatives product depth and commission structure make it one of the stronger crypto exchange affiliate programs outside the US.

The US situation, clearly stated upfront

Bybit does not serve US users. This isn't a gray area or a technicality. Bybit explicitly excluded US customers due to US regulatory requirements around crypto derivatives and exchange licensing.

For affiliates, this means:

If you're based in the US, you cannot join the Bybit affiliate program.

If you're based outside the US but your audience is primarily in the US, you cannot direct US traffic to Bybit through your affiliate links.

If your content is in English and ranks globally, check your analytics. If 40 percent of your traffic is from the US, that's a compliance problem for Bybit promotion.

Bybit checks for this. Applications from US affiliates or affiliates with clear US-primary audiences get rejected. If you somehow get approved and start sending US traffic, that puts your account at risk.

The fix if you have a mixed audience: either segment your content (US audience gets Coinbase/Kraken links, non-US audience gets Bybit links) or pick programs that work globally like Kraken for your entire audience.

With that out of the way, here's why Bybit is worth discussing for non-US affiliates.

How Bybit's tiered structure actually works

Bybit's affiliate program is built around trading fee revenue share with tiers that reward volume.

The baseline for most new affiliates starting out is around 30 percent of trading fees generated by referred users. This is what you should assume you'll start at.

As your referred users' trading volume grows and you consistently send active traders, Bybit reviews your tier. Higher tiers unlock higher commission percentages, moving from the base 30 percent toward 40 percent, 45 percent, and up to 50 percent for top-performing affiliates.

Real math at different volume levels:

ScenarioMonthly referred trading volumeAvg trading fees (~0.1%)At 30%At 45%At 50%
Small creator$50,000$50$15$22.50$25
Medium creator$500,000$500$150$225$250
Large creator$5M$5,000$1,500$2,250$2,500
Top affiliate$50M+$50,000+$15,000+$22,500+$25,000+

The jump from 30 percent to 50 percent is significant on large volumes. It's less meaningful at small volumes because the absolute dollar difference is small. Focus on growing the number of active traders you refer, not obsessing over your tier percentage until you have real volume.

One more important factor: Bybit's trading fees are based on derivatives contracts, spot trades, and other products. Derivatives traders generally trade larger volumes than spot investors. An active futures trader can generate more fee revenue in a month than a casual spot buyer generates in a year. Content that attracts derivatives-focused users is worth more per referral.

Bybit's product advantages for affiliate content

Bybit has features that genuinely differentiate its content angles from standard spot exchange promotion.

Copy trading. Bybit's copy trading feature lets users automatically replicate the trades of successful experienced traders. You follow a master trader, and when they execute a trade, your account executes the same trade proportionally. For content creators, this is a rich topic. "How Bybit copy trading works," "best copy traders to follow on Bybit," "is copy trading profitable," "copy trading vs trading yourself." These questions have real search volume and the audience is ready to sign up and deposit funds to start.

Derivatives depth. Bybit is one of the strongest exchanges for perpetual futures and crypto derivatives. It offers USDT perpetuals, inverse contracts, and options across hundreds of trading pairs. For content targeting active traders who want to trade Bitcoin futures, Ethereum perps, or altcoin derivatives, Bybit is a more appropriate recommendation than Coinbase (which has very limited derivatives) or even Kraken (which has derivatives but less product depth).

Web3 and DeFi features. Bybit has expanded into Web3 with an NFT marketplace, Web3 wallet integration, and DeFi product access. This gives creators covering the Web3 and DeFi space a reason to cover Bybit specifically.

Geo coverage

Bybit's strongest markets by user base and affiliate conversion:

Asia: Southeast Asia (Vietnam, Thailand, Indonesia, Philippines, Malaysia), South Korea, Japan. Bybit built its name in Asian crypto markets and has deep penetration there. Asian-language content promoting Bybit outperforms English content on a per-user basis for obvious reasons.

Middle East: UAE, Turkey, Saudi Arabia. Bybit has grown significantly in Middle Eastern crypto markets, which have high per-capita crypto adoption rates. Arabic and Turkish content for these markets is underserved by most affiliates.

Europe: Germany, France, UK, Spain, Eastern Europe. European crypto adoption is growing and Bybit is available with increasingly clear regulatory presence under EU frameworks. The UK is available though check current UK-specific terms around derivative products and FCA guidance.

Restricted: US, and various other jurisdictions by product type. Always verify the current restricted countries list before creating content for a specific market.

How to apply and which tier you'll start in

Step 1. Create a Bybit account

You need a Bybit account to apply for the affiliate program. Create one at bybit.com if you don't have one. Note: creating an account from the US is itself against Bybit's terms. Only proceed if you're in an eligible jurisdiction.

Step 2. Navigate to the affiliate or partner section

Inside your Bybit account, find the affiliate or partner program section. The application form asks for your traffic sources, content type, audience geography, estimated monthly traffic, and your planned promotion approach.

Step 3. Submit the application

Be specific about your non-US audience mix. If your content is primarily in English targeting specific non-US markets, explain that clearly. Vague applications or applications without clear non-US traffic sources may get more scrutiny or rejection.

Step 4. Start at the base tier

Most new affiliates start at the base commission level (around 30 percent). After demonstrating consistent traffic and active referral volume, Bybit reviews tier upgrades. The timeline for tier upgrades varies and Bybit does this through their affiliate manager system rather than automatic thresholds.

Step 5. Build volume to unlock higher tiers

The path to 45 to 50 percent is through consistent referral of active traders. One high-volume derivatives trader referred per month has more impact on your tier review than fifty casual spot buyers. Focus content on audiences likely to trade actively.

Bybit vs Binance vs Kraken for non-US affiliates

Program Starting rate Max rate Attribution Derivatives CPA option Best market
Bybit~30%50%Referral linkExcellentBy approvalAsia, Middle East
BinanceVariesUp to 50%VariesYesYesGlobal non-US
Kraken~40% futuresUp to 50%LifetimeGoodBy negotiationEU, UK, global
OKXVariesVariesVariesYesYesAsia especially

Why pick Bybit over Binance: Binance has had more program volatility and regional restrictions tighten and loosen unpredictably. Bybit's affiliate program has been more stable in terms and communication. Bybit's copy trading feature also gives unique content angles you can't use for Binance.

Why pick Kraken over Bybit for European audiences: Kraken has clearer regulatory standing in the EU and UK and explicitly lifetime attribution. For European affiliates who want the cleaner compliance story, Kraken is a safer choice. For Asian or Middle Eastern audiences where Bybit has stronger brand recognition, Bybit converts better.

FAQ

How much does the Bybit affiliate program pay?
Up to 50 percent of trading fees on a tiered structure. New affiliates typically start around 30 percent. Tier upgrades to 40, 45, and 50 percent happen as your referred trading volume grows. Some partner structures include sub-affiliate overrides. Commission is paid in crypto.
Is Bybit available for US affiliates?
No. Bybit does not serve US users and does not accept US-based affiliates or affiliates directing US traffic to Bybit. If you're in the US or your primary audience is in the US, use Coinbase or Kraken instead. This is a hard restriction, not a gray area.
What is the Bybit affiliate cookie length?
Bybit uses referral link and referral ID-based attribution. When a user registers through your referral link, they're associated with your affiliate account. The attribution is based on account creation through your link rather than a traditional browser cookie with a fixed expiry.
What is Bybit's CPA option?
CPA (cost per acquisition) structures are available for some approved Bybit partners. Not self-serve. Requires approval from a Bybit affiliate manager based on your traffic quality, volume, and geographic mix. The default program is revenue share on trading fees. If you want CPA, apply normally first and then raise it with your affiliate manager after approval.
How does Bybit's tiered commission work?
New affiliates start at the base tier (around 30 percent of trading fees). Tier upgrades are reviewed by Bybit based on your referral volume, active trader numbers, and overall program performance. Higher tiers unlock 40, 45, and up to 50 percent. The path to higher tiers requires consistent active referrals of traders who generate real trading volume.

Can I run paid ads to promote Bybit?
Yes for generic crypto keywords in eligible non-US markets. Not allowed: targeting US audiences, using Bybit brand terms as search keywords without authorization, misleading content, or any promotion that implies Bybit serves US customers. Paid traffic must be geo-targeted to exclude US if you run campaigns. Check current Bybit affiliate terms for specific paid traffic rules.
How does Bybit pay affiliates?
Commission is paid in crypto, typically settled in USDT or other supported digital assets to your Bybit account or linked wallet. Payout frequency and minimum thresholds are specified in your affiliate dashboard after approval. Check current payout terms at the time of application as these can change.
